Infinite Distance Light Biological Microscope represents the advanced standard in modern microscopy. Unlike finite optical systems, its core design features an “infinity-corrected” optical path. Here, light rays exiting the objective lens travel as parallel beams over an “infinite” distance until converging through a separate tube lens to form the primary image.
This system comprises several key components: infinity-corrected objectives (marked with an infinity symbol ∞), the tube lens integrated into the microscope body, high-eyepoint eyepieces, and often auxiliary filter cubes or modules placed in the parallel light path.
The advantages are significant. It provides superior mechanical stability and flexibility, allowing the insertion of accessories like polarizers, DIC prisms, or fluorescence filters into the spacious parallel beam without introducing optical aberrations or image shift. This maintains consistent image quality and parfocality. Furthermore, it enables extended working distances, particularly beneficial for micromanipulation techniques.
Delivering exceptional contrast, resolution, and flatness of field, this microscope is indispensable for demanding applications in cell biology, pathology, developmental studies, and advanced research, where precise observation and documentation of detailed specimen structures are crucial. It is the foundation for most contemporary high-performance compound microscopes.
